She won gold medals in the 100m, 200m and 4x400m relay in Sydney along with bronze medals in the long jump and 4x100m relay, becoming the first woman to win fivemedals at a single Olympics.
Jeter's time - the fifth-fastest ever run - was 0.18 sec behind Griffith-Joyner's world record of 10.49 sec and 0.02 sec behind the quickest time ever run by Jones, who was stripped of her fivemedals from the 2000 Olympics after admitting using steroids.
